Fuel retailers like Shell typically make a few pence profit on every litre of fuel we sell in the UK. The market is highly competitive, and we are constantly balancing the wholesale prices of petrol and diesel and our own retail costs, including staff costs, rent, electricity, maintenance and marketing, with the level of competition in the local area and the number of customers visiting each site.
